About Dinkel brot

Dinkel Brot, or spelt bread, is a traditional European bread originating from Germany, valued for its wholesome ingredients and hearty flavor. Made primarily with spelt flour, water, yeast, and salt, this bread often incorporates seeds or grains for additional texture and nutrients. Spelt, an ancient grain, is rich in fiber, protein, and essential vitamins like B-complex vitamins, making Dinkel Brot a nutritious alternative to breads made with refined wheat flour. Its lower gluten content compared to conventional wheat can make it easier to digest for some individuals, though it's not suitable for those with gluten intolerance or celiac disease. Dense and flavorful, Dinkel Brot aligns closely with German baking traditions, emphasizing natural, minimally processed ingredients. While healthy overall, its carbohydrate content should be considered in moderation for those managing blood sugar levels.
